Paul, best thing to do is have a read through the build logs, this will give you a good idea what people are building machines for & give you some ideas about the best way to design your machine. It's hard to point people in the right direction for anything without knowing what the machine is wanted for, ie do you have a specific purpose in mind & what sort of materials do you want to be able to cut.
